Cleansing
A little dust and gunk is to be expected after a weekend camping trip. But if you go back to your outdoor tents and notification unsightly stains or funky smells, it's time for a deep tidy.

Collect your cleansing materials, including a non-abrasive sponge, a tub of cool to lukewarm water and some light recipe soap. Begin by spot cleansing any kind of extra-dirty locations, then immerse the entire outdoor tents and rainfly in sudsy water. Adhere to the directions on your cleaner's bottle to see for how long to soak your equipment.

Wash the camping tent and rainfly completely, then dry entirely prior to keeping. Be sure to stay clear of long term direct exposure to sunlight or high temperatures, which can weaken materials and concession water-proof finishes.

It's important to keep your Overland Ground Camping tent appropriately to keep it in good condition. Ideally, your camping tent ought to be kept level and safeguarded. Utilize a durable storage space bag to help prevent moisture and dust from harming your outdoor tents.

A hanging system is another prominent storage space approach that helps to keep your garage area open while streamlining re-installation in the spring. Ensure your camping tent is supported below with 2x4 lumber every 18 inches to stop the tent from resting on its latches and hinges, which can harm it with time.
